Screenshot of Equinox Game

Technologies: Java, Java Swing

View Code →


EQUINOX

A fast-paced, top-down space shooter game where players pilot the spacecraft captained by Nova, battling through waves of enemies across different locations in the galaxy.

Key Features

  • Top-down space shooter gameplay
  • Wave-based enemy combat system
  • Player-controlled spacecraft with shooting mechanics
  • Multiple galaxy locations
  • Score tracking and progression

Tech Stack & Architecture

  • Language: Java
  • Framework: Java Swing for GUI and game rendering
  • Architecture: Object-oriented design with game loop pattern

Project Information

Academic game development project focusing on object-oriented programming principles and Java Swing GUI development.

View Full Documentation on GitHub →